Paiton and PLN

Thank you for your story headlined "Paiton Energy dismayed by court's decision" of Dec. 4.

There was a mistake and misperception in the story that needs to be corrected.

Regarding the lawsuit of the State Electricity Company (PLN) against Paiton Energy, you stated that the "court made the provisional ruling at the request of PLN, which had sued Paiton at the court following the latter's refusal to renegotiate with the state company on its power purchase contract."

That is incorrect. Paiton Energy and PLN were in the midst of renegotiations which progressed significantly toward a settlement when PLN surprised us by abruptly breaking off discussions and filing suit at the Jakarta Central District Court.

Paiton has always been willing to renegotiate its contract with PLN. In spite of PLN's legal efforts, we reaffirm our preference to resolve our issues through negotiation rather than litigation or arbitration, all as part of our ongoing commitment to help the government and people of Indonesia through the current economic difficulties.

To this end, we have time and again provided concessions to PLN, which they have unfortunately rejected.
